Three Changes in Lung Nodules

The changes in the lung nodes within three months of reexamination usually required close attention. If there was no obvious change in the lung node during this period, that is, the diameter did not increase or decrease by more than 2 mm, it was generally considered stable. In this case, it could be considered to extend the interval between reexaminations to 6 or 12 months. However, if the lung node had a significant increase or decrease of more than 2 mm within three months, especially if it increased by more than 8 mm, it would require a high degree of vigilance and there might be a risk of malignant tumors. In this case, it is recommended to consult a surgeon to determine if surgery is needed. In general, during the reexamination of lung nodes, a change in diameter of less than 2 mm was usually caused by measurement errors, not a real change in the size of the node. If the follow-up showed that the tumor had shrunk, it was usually good news. However, if the tumor grows significantly in a short period of time, it may be inflammation or a highly malignant tumor in a few cases. However, if the tumor enlarged significantly over a long period of time, it was necessary to be on high alert for the possibility of malignant tumor.

What does a ground-glass lung signify?

A ground-glass lung tumor was an imaging finding. It referred to the appearance of a high-density shadow with a clear or unclear boundary in the lungs. There were three possible reasons for the ground-glass nodes in the lungs: inflammation, benign tumors, and malignant tumors. Whether it was serious or not needed to be judged based on the results of the examination. Ground-glass nodes could be inflammation, such as bacteria infection, fungus infection, allergy, vasculitides, etc. If treated in time, it would not be serious. Benign tumors usually had clear borders and were less than 5mm in size, but sometimes the borders were blurry. In a few cases, ground-glass nodes may be malignant tumors, especially in patients over the age of 40 who smoked for a long time, were exposed to secondhand smoke, or had a family history of malignant tumors. If the density of the ground-glass nodes becomes uneven, the nodes become larger, or there are signs of malignant transformation, such as blood vessel signs, void signs, and pleura depression signs, further examination and early treatment may be needed. In short, the specific significance of the lung ground-glass nodes needed to be analyzed according to the medical history, the characteristics of the nodes, and the results of the follow-up examination.

pulmonary nodules

A lung nodulus was a circular shadow less than 3 centimeters in diameter found on lung imaging. The formation of lung nodes may be related to many factors such as infection and tumors. The types of lung nodes included solid nodes, partially solid nodes, and ground-glass nodes. The causes of lung lumps may include smoking, working in dusty jobs, lung infection, and air pollution. Lung nodes could be signs of inflammation, chemotherapy, or tumors. Most lung nodes were benign, and only a few were malignant. Generally speaking, most of the nodes below 6 mm were benign, but it needed to be judged based on the size, shape, location, density, and other characteristics of the nodes. The treatment of lung nodes needed to be evaluated and decided according to the specific situation.

The probability of a pure ground-glass shadow being malignant

The malignant probability of pure ground-glass nodes was about 18%, which was higher than 7% for solid nodes and lower than 63% for mixed ground-glass nodes. However, the risk of malignant tumor was also related to the size and shape of the lung nodes. For example, the malignant rate of lung nodes <8mm was very low, while the malignant rate of lung nodes>8mm was higher than 15%. Lung Atrophy

The symptoms of lung atrophy included chest tightness, short breath, difficulty breathing, fatigue, cough, and expectoration. Atrophy of the lungs could also lead to organ failure throughout the body. The severity of the symptoms depended on the degree and cause of the lung contraction. Lung contraction could be caused by bronchi obstruction, pneumothorax, chest effusions, lung cancer, lung trauma, congenital maldevelopment, etc. Patients with mild lung atrophy may not have obvious symptoms, while patients with severe lung disease may experience severe decline in lung function, resulting in chest tightness, short of breath, difficulty breathing, and other symptoms. The treatment methods for lung atrophy included medication and surgery, and the specifics needed to be determined according to the patient's condition.
